Tucked away in the stunning valleys of Limpopo province, Magoebaskloof offers a serene escape from the hectic world. Here, amidst lush hills and azure rivers, you'll discover cozy self-catering cottages, each offering https://cyrusbnhd256124.webdesign96.com/38724780/retreat-to-magoebaskloof-comfortable-cottages-await